Sunomono Salad
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 15 Minutes
Cook Time: 3 Minutes
Ready In: 18 Minutes
Servings: 4
This light, refreshing salad is a great start to any Japanese meal. I enjoy this fresh salad as a starter to a sushi dinner or alone for a light lunch. This is also a basic recipe to prepare.
Ingredients:
1/2 cup rice vinegar (not seasoned)
3 tablespoons granulated sugar
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on sake
1 dash soy sauce
1/4 teaspoon grated gingerroot
1/4 lb shrimp (cooked)
1/4 lb crabmeat (or artificial crab)
1/2 cucumber, thinly sliced
250 g of thin rice noodles (harasume)
2 green onions, sliced on a sharp diagonal
Directions:
1. Mix all the marinade ingredients together and set aside.
2. Bring water to a boil and put in noodles, Stir noodles for 3-4 minutes until cooked . Drain the noodles in a colander and cool under running cold water, drain as much water off you can.
3. Mix cooked cooled noodles, green onions, cucumber, shrimp and crab meat in a bowl. Pour marinade over noodles. Mix well, cover and refrigerate allowing the flavors to combine (just an hour or two). Serve cold.
